The committee recommended Resolution No. 1730 for the October 6 consent agenda, updating authorization for change and petty cash funds at the Sumner Senior Center. Staff also reported that a mechanic was hired, two positions remain in recruitment, negotiations with the Teamsters Union are ongoing, and the FY2024 audit is still underway.

The petty cash update would allow the City to maintain cash funds for routine transactions at the Sumner Senior Center after operations returned to City control. The committee took no further action on the audit or monthly sales tax report. The Teamsters contract has been expired since the end of 2024, and negotiations are continuing.
